Ottonian Revival
Refers to the renaissance of arts and architecture in the Holy Roman Empire during the reign of the Ottonian dynasty (10th-early 11th century), marked by the revitalization of Romanesque architectural and artistic styles.
Large-Scale Sculpture
A form of sculpture that is characterized by its large size, often towering over the viewer and requiring significant space for installation.
Bernward Crucifix
A Romanesque period crucifix that showcases the skill of Ottonian art, particularly known for its realism and emotional depth.
Carolingian Architectural
Relating to the architectural style that developed during the reign of the Carolingian dynasty in Western Europe (8th-10th century), characterized by the revival of Roman building techniques and forms.
